    On August 16th, in Kuroishi, Aomori Prefecture, a traditional event called "Orakawara no Higarashi" was held.

    The event is held on the evening of August 16 every year in the Okawara district in the eastern part of Kuroishi City, and has a history of more than 650 years. It is said that the Shinano aristocrats, who had fallen during the Northern and Southern Dynasties, started to commemorate the deaths of the South Korean war victims and to back home.

    Young people dressed in stray clothing set fire to three small boats with sail pillars of less than 3 meters in height woven with reeds, etc., and pulled the boat down the Nakano River flowing through the area. The three vessels are seen as early, middle, and late, respectively, and are used to fortune the next year's agricultural illness and pray for people's illness and harm from the way they burn.

    "I was interested in Japanese traditional events," said Ian Hamilton, a foreign language teaching assistant in the city who attended the event. It was the second time to participate this year, and he said, "I was able to walk in the river better than last year." "I'm happy that I'm participating in one of the communities," he said.

    According to the sponsored "Okawara Hirashi Conservation Society", the number of young people participating is decreasing year by year, and in recent years, people from outside the area are calling for participation. Foreigners have never participated in the past, saying, "Three times you will be able to be called a full-fledged person. Please join us next year." It is said that applicants for participation after next year are also being recruited at any time.
